I have a 15/16 inch front sway bar and 7 leaf rear spring on my '68. Did smallblocks come with this setup?
Also I am having a bit of body roll in the back when I am cornering, will a rear sway bar help this? The car has been fitted with one before, but it has been removed...
There can be many reasons for excessive body roll. Firstly are your shocks in good condition? They are more likely to be the cause of the body roll you are complaining about. Or it could be worn bushings allowing the rear wheel to tuck under during cornering. A rear sway bar is not necessarily a good thing since with it the break away of the rear of your car happens suddenly, without it, its much more progressive. I would check your bushings and try fitting good gas shocks first.
